Weary from his sleepless nights, Yuki, an ordinary high school student, finds himself thrown into a ruthless trial by a mysterious system which promises him a chance to shed his mortality, lest he manage to survive.

But all is not as it seems. In a world where gods reign supreme at the forefront of their domains, Yuki is unwillingly thrust into an intricate web of divine plots as The Veil opens to him. Making him inevitably choose, what was it he wanted? freedom or divinity.

I find this to be an interesting twist on your usual isekai story. Not necessarily because if any certain gimmick or plot, but because of the pacing and tone. The pacing feels deliberate, refusing to rush even for the jump through worlds. There's a sort of grim, greyish tone to the story that matches Yuki's mental state. He's exhausted, lethargic, and a touch nihilistic, which the story seems to reflect in pacing and subtle details.

Many isekai jump right out of the gate into action and explosions or some kind if punchy hook. This one feels like it deliberately refuses to. The plot will unravel in its own time, and so shall the answers come.

Although initially used primarily for humor and a sense of frustration, Yuki's androgynous nature may also end up coming into play in interesting ways, as his appearance deviates from your average nondescript isekai lead.

For that, though...I guess we'll have to wait and see.
